The Story
Jacob Cooper was a three-year-old boy who had a near-death experience caused by whooping cough. The illness made him suffocate while he stood at the top of a slide ladder on a playground. He stopped breathing and blacked out. During the NDE, Jacob left his body and watched people around him, but they could not hear him. His guides pushed his unresponsive body down the slide. He entered a dark tunnel vortex that led to a bright light. There, he encountered God as a golden palace and felt profound love and home. He saw angels in a choir, sensed Jesus' presence, and viewed the earth from above, seeing past lives, future events, and his soul family. He felt embarrassed for returning early but chose to come back after seeing his future role. After the NDE, Jacob overcame anxiety and anger from the trauma. He became a clinical social worker, Reiki master, and hypnotherapist focused on past life regression. He wrote the book Life After Breath and leads seminars on spiritual awareness and empowerment.

The NDE includes a basic out-of-body perception claim of seeing people around the unresponsive body at the park, but lacks specific, unpredictable details and any verification. No corroborated physical observations from an impossible vantage point are reported, limiting evidential value.
